Transaction 2c684ba01fd00cc26ea28ed95c0b0f102c0a365ffcabc6f46cb36e12070876e2
1 Input
1 Output
-
2c684ba01fd00cc26ea28ed95c0b0f102c0a365ffcabc6f46cb36e12070876e2:0
- value
- 8787987
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a993d238ca13ecd1874036985041846c3a167f3
- address
- bc1qt2vn6guv5ylv6xr5qd5c2pqcgmp6zelnskw4fk